Where Does Your Shed Waste Actually Go?
Your broken lawnmower doesn't simply disappear into a landfill. We operate a recycling-first policy that diverts up to 90% of collected waste from landfill sites, sorting items at licensed transfer stations across the region.
Metals from garden tools and white goods go to scrap processors. Timber—even treated wood—gets separated for biomass energy generation. WEEE items (electrical appliances) are processed through certified facilities that safely extract hazardous components and recover valuable materials. Reusable items in decent condition go to local charities and community reuse centres, giving them a second life.
You'll receive a waste transfer note documenting where your waste went, fulfilling your legal duty of care. This isn't just paperwork—it's proof your shed contents were handled responsibly and legally. Many customers keep these records for property sales, rental deposits, or business compliance.
What We Remove (And What We Can't)
Our licensed waste carriers can handle almost everything typically stored in sheds, garages, and outbuildings:
We remove: Sofas, mattresses, and household furniture · Fridges, freezers, and white goods · Washing machines, tumble dryers, and appliances · Garden furniture, BBQs, and outdoor equipment · Lawnmowers, tools, and DIY equipment · Bicycles, gym equipment, and sports gear · Carpets, flooring, and DIY waste · Boxes, bags, and general household rubbish · Builders' waste from renovation projects (non-hazardous) · Office furniture, filing cabinets, and commercial items · Garden waste, soil, and green waste
We cannot take: Asbestos or materials containing asbestos · Gas bottles, canisters, or compressed gases · Chemicals, paints, or hazardous liquids · Medical waste or sharps · Tyres (commercial quantities) · Firearms, ammunition, or explosives
If you're uncertain about any items, describe them when you call. We'll advise on legal disposal routes for anything we can't take—for example, local recycling centres often accept small quantities of paint and chemicals from residents free of charge.

Are you licensed and insured for waste removal?
Absolutely. We're licensed waste carriers registered with the Environment Agency—you can verify our license if needed. We carry full public liability insurance covering your property during clearance work. You'll receive a waste transfer note for every job, which is your legal proof that waste was handed to an authorized carrier. Using unlicensed operators puts you at risk of fines up to £400 if your waste is later found fly-tipped.
